QGIS API Documentation  2.14.11-Essen
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ends Macros Modules Pages
QgsDxfRuleBasedLabelProvider Member List

This is the complete list of members for QgsDxfRuleBasedLabelProvider, including all inherited members.

CentroidMustBeInside enum valueQgsAbstractLabelProvider
createProvider(QgsVectorLayer *layer, bool withFeatureLoop, const QgsPalLayerSettings *settings) overrideQgsDxfRuleBasedLabelProvidervirtual
DrawAllLabels enum valueQgsAbstractLabelProvider
drawLabel(QgsRenderContext &context, pal::LabelPosition *label) const overrideQgsDxfRuleBasedLabelProvidervirtual
drawLabelPrivate(pal::LabelPosition *label, QgsRenderContext &context, QgsPalLayerSettings &tmpLyr, QgsPalLabeling::DrawLabelType drawType, double dpiRatio=1.0) const QgsVectorLayerLabelProviderprotected
DrawLabels enum valueQgsAbstractLabelProvider
Flag enum nameQgsAbstractLabelProvider
flags() const QgsAbstractLabelProviderinline
getPointObstacleGeometry(QgsFeature &fet, QgsRenderContext &context, const QgsSymbolV2List &symbols)QgsVectorLayerLabelProviderstatic
init()QgsVectorLayerLabelProviderprotected
labelFeatures(QgsRenderContext &context) overrideQgsVectorLayerLabelProvidervirtual
LabelPerFeaturePart enum valueQgsAbstractLabelProvider
layerId() const QgsAbstractLabelProviderinline
linePlacementFlags() const QgsAbstractLabelProviderinline
mCrsQgsVectorLayerLabelProviderprotected
mDxfExportQgsDxfRuleBasedLabelProviderprotected
mEngineQgsAbstractLabelProviderprotected
MergeConnectedLines enum valueQgsAbstractLabelProvider
mFieldsQgsVectorLayerLabelProviderprotected
mFlagsQgsAbstractLabelProviderprotected
mLabelsQgsVectorLayerLabelProviderprotected
mLayerGeometryTypeQgsVectorLayerLabelProviderprotected
mLayerIdQgsAbstractLabelProviderprotected
mLinePlacementFlagsQgsAbstractLabelProviderprotected
mNameQgsAbstractLabelProviderprotected
mObstacleTypeQgsAbstractLabelProviderprotected
mOwnsSourceQgsVectorLayerLabelProviderprotected
mPlacementQgsAbstractLabelProviderprotected
mPriorityQgsAbstractLabelProviderprotected
mRendererQgsVectorLayerLabelProviderprotected
mRulesQgsRuleBasedLabelProviderprotected
mSettingsQgsVectorLayerLabelProviderprotected
mSourceQgsVectorLayerLabelProviderprotected
mSubProvidersQgsRuleBasedLabelProviderprotected
mUpsidedownLabelsQgsAbstractLabelProviderprotected
name() const QgsAbstractLabelProviderinline
obstacleType() const QgsAbstractLabelProviderinline
placement() const QgsAbstractLabelProviderinline
prepare(const QgsRenderContext &context, QStringList &attributeNames) overrideQgsRuleBasedLabelProvidervirtual
priority() const QgsAbstractLabelProviderinline
QgsAbstractLabelProvider(const QString &layerId=QString())QgsAbstractLabelProvider
QgsDxfRuleBasedLabelProvider(const QgsRuleBasedLabeling &rules, QgsVectorLayer *layer, QgsDxfExport *dxf)QgsDxfRuleBasedLabelProviderexplicit
QgsRuleBasedLabelProvider(const QgsRuleBasedLabeling &rules, QgsVectorLayer *layer, bool withFeatureLoop=true)QgsRuleBasedLabelProvider
QgsVectorLayerLabelProvider(QgsVectorLayer *layer, bool withFeatureLoop=true, const QgsPalLayerSettings *settings=nullptr, const QString &layerName=QString())QgsVectorLayerLabelProviderexplicit
QgsVectorLayerLabelProvider(const QgsPalLayerSettings &settings, const QString &layerId, const QgsFields &fields, const QgsCoordinateReferenceSystem &crs, QgsAbstractFeatureSource *source, bool ownsSource, QgsFeatureRendererV2 *renderer=nullptr)QgsVectorLayerLabelProvider
registerDxfFeature(QgsFeature &feature, QgsRenderContext &context, const QString &dxfLayerName)QgsDxfRuleBasedLabelProvider
registerFeature(QgsFeature &feature, QgsRenderContext &context, QgsGeometry *obstacleGeometry=nullptr) overrideQgsRuleBasedLabelProvidervirtual
reinit(QgsVectorLayer *layer)QgsDxfRuleBasedLabelProvider
setEngine(const QgsLabelingEngineV2 *engine)QgsAbstractLabelProviderinline
subProviders() overrideQgsRuleBasedLabelProvidervirtual
upsidedownLabels() const QgsAbstractLabelProviderinline
~QgsAbstractLabelProvider()QgsAbstractLabelProviderinlinevirtual
~QgsRuleBasedLabelProvider()QgsRuleBasedLabelProvider
~QgsVectorLayerLabelProvider()QgsVectorLayerLabelProvider